The Verdict: Which is Better?

When placing Cake Up Brownie and Milk Chocolate Large Bar side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.

For calorie-conscious consumers, Cake Up Brownie is the clear winner. With 109 fewer calories per 100g than its competitor, it allows for more volume while keeping your energy intake in check.

In terms of sugar control, Cake Up Brownie takes the lead with only 42.5g of sugar per 100g, whereas Milk Chocolate Large Bar contains 61.2g. Lower sugar content is often linked to better metabolic health.
